Output ff6fe6d21650d0cc2858c7438f6f374368d5d898e2b94560180d8f15e1042ed7:2

value
24461065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a3b184d046d2ce416f3e8fb823c31e69896f99 OP_EQUAL
address
MHAaaRZ9XdeFswM8Eb95mW2n9bUbMtosB2
transaction
ff6fe6d21650d0cc2858c7438f6f374368d5d898e2b94560180d8f15e1042ed7
spent
true